I used both stencils and die cuts on my A3 mixed media piece.  The background was painted using a mixture of gesso and cream and pink coloured paint used through a floral stencil. The birds were added with a Dina Wakley stencil, and the cat was made with a hand-made stencil. The embellishments are all die cuts cut from recycled calendar pages. The cat was painted with acrylics using a white marker pen for the details:
